summaryrefslogtreecommitdiffstats
path: root/test/test_fsoptium.py
diff options
context:
space:
mode:
authorBen <b-schaefer@posteo.de>2020-02-21 10:45:40 +0100
committerDiego Elio Pettenò <flameeyes@flameeyes.com>2020-03-08 00:36:39 +0100
commite72b02d84e7f67cdf6107862ad580e951a5bbda1 (patch)
tree0887513d2478f55b27abccfeb307f313231bd994 /test/test_fsoptium.py
parentpre-commit guide in README (diff)
downloadglucometerutils-e72b02d84e7f67cdf6107862ad580e951a5bbda1.tar
glucometerutils-e72b02d84e7f67cdf6107862ad580e951a5bbda1.tar.gz
glucometerutils-e72b02d84e7f67cdf6107862ad580e951a5bbda1.tar.bz2
glucometerutils-e72b02d84e7f67cdf6107862ad580e951a5bbda1.tar.lz
glucometerutils-e72b02d84e7f67cdf6107862ad580e951a5bbda1.tar.xz
glucometerutils-e72b02d84e7f67cdf6107862ad580e951a5bbda1.tar.zst
glucometerutils-e72b02d84e7f67cdf6107862ad580e951a5bbda1.zip
Diffstat (limited to 'test/test_fsoptium.py')
-rw-r--r--test/test_fsoptium.py25
1 files changed, 9 insertions, 16 deletions
diff --git a/test/test_fsoptium.py b/test/test_fsoptium.py
index d9a1ccb..bdc76f8 100644
--- a/test/test_fsoptium.py
+++ b/test/test_fsoptium.py
@@ -8,31 +8,24 @@
import datetime
from absl.testing import parameterized
-
-from glucometerutils.drivers import fsoptium
from glucometerutils import exceptions
+from glucometerutils.drivers import fsoptium
class TestFreeStyleOptium(parameterized.TestCase):
-
@parameterized.parameters(
- ('Clock:\tApr 22 2014\t02:14:37',
- datetime.datetime(2014, 4, 22, 2, 14, 37)),
- ('Clock:\tJul 10 2013\t14:26:44',
- datetime.datetime(2013, 7, 10, 14, 26, 44)),
- ('Clock:\tSep 29 2013\t17:35:34',
- datetime.datetime(2013, 9, 29, 17, 35, 34)),
+ ("Clock:\tApr 22 2014\t02:14:37", datetime.datetime(2014, 4, 22, 2, 14, 37)),
+ ("Clock:\tJul 10 2013\t14:26:44", datetime.datetime(2013, 7, 10, 14, 26, 44)),
+ ("Clock:\tSep 29 2013\t17:35:34", datetime.datetime(2013, 9, 29, 17, 35, 34)),
)
def test_parse_clock(self, datestr, datevalue):
- self.assertEqual(
- fsoptium._parse_clock(datestr),
- datevalue)
+ self.assertEqual(fsoptium._parse_clock(datestr), datevalue)
@parameterized.parameters(
- ('Apr 22 2014 02:14:37',),
- ('Clock:\tXxx 10 2013\t14:26',),
- ('Clock:\tSep 29 2013\t17:35:22.34',),
- ('Foo',)
+ ("Apr 22 2014 02:14:37",),
+ ("Clock:\tXxx 10 2013\t14:26",),
+ ("Clock:\tSep 29 2013\t17:35:22.34",),
+ ("Foo",),
)
def test_parse_clock_invalid(self, datestr):
with self.assertRaises(exceptions.InvalidResponse):